+// SendMail is a convenience method used to call SendMail using an APIInfo 
structure's configuration.
+func (inf *APIInfo) SendMail(to rfc.EmailAddress, msg []byte) (int, error, 
error) {
+       return SendMail(to, msg, inf.Config)
+}
+
+// SendMail sends an email msg to the address identified by to. The msg 
parameter should be an
+// RFC822-style email with headers first, a blank line, and then the message 
body. The lines of msg
+// should be CRLF terminated. The msg headers should usually include fields 
such as "From", "To",
+// "Subject", and "Cc". Sending "Bcc" messages is accomplished by including an 
email address in the
+// to parameter but not including it in the msg headers.
+// The cfg parameter is used to set things like the "From" field, as well as 
for connection
+// and authentication with an external SMTP server.
+// SendMail returns (in order) an HTTP status code, a user-friendly error, and 
an error fit for
+// logging to system error logs. If either the user or system error is 
non-nil, the operation failed,
+// and the HTTP status code indicates the type of failure.
+func SendMail(to rfc.EmailAddress, msg []byte, cfg *config.Config) (int, 
error, error) {
+       if !cfg.SMTP.Enabled {
+               return http.StatusServiceUnavailable, errors.New("SMTP is not 
enabled!"), nil
+       }
+       auth := smtp.PlainAuth("", cfg.SMTP.User, cfg.SMTP.Password, 
strings.Split(cfg.SMTP.Address, ":")[0])
+       err := smtp.SendMail(cfg.SMTP.Address, auth, 
cfg.ConfigTO.EmailFrom.String(), []string{to.String()}, msg)
+       if err != nil {
+               return http.StatusBadGateway, nil, err
